OCBC profit slumps 15% as loans decline

-

Oversea-Chinese Banking Corp, Southeast Asia’s second-largest lender, reported a 15 percent decline in quarterly profit as loans contracted and income from its insurance unit slumped. Net income fell to S$885 million ($654 million) in the three months to June from S$1.05 billion a year earlier, the Singapore-based bank reported on Thursday.
